Issues can emerge when unclogging any kind of kind of drainpipe line. Below are some common troubles that can occur. If the sewer wire gets stuck and the plumbing technician can not obtain it, the plumber will certainly have to expose the drainpipe to obtain the cable television.
If it's outside the home, it suggests excavating up the sewage system line, reducing the sewer pipe and getting the cable television. Inside will call for backfilling the hole, putting concrete and replacing the floor covering. Outside will need fixing the sewer pipe, backfilling the trench and replacing the landscaping. This is a rare incident, yet it can take place sometimes.
Toilet augers periodically get stuck in bathrooms. Occasionally the plumber can retrieve it. Otherwise, you'll need a brand-new toilet because the plumber typically breaks it attempting to get rid of the auger. You can not unclog all commodes with an auger. If auguring falls short, the plumber will get rid of the bathroom to remove the obstruction.

There are a number of types of pipelines made use of in Arizona building. Here are the sewage system pipe kinds we consistently find in the Phoenix metro cosmopolitan location. Several older homes created in the 40's thru the early 70's made use of Orangeburg outside piping for their drain system piping outside to link from the home to the city sewage system.
If your sewage system line is Orangeburg, the ideal point to do is change it. Cast iron is used mainly inside the home for both drain and sewage system piping. Older homes often have cast iron pipes, and numerous homes in Phase I and Stage II in Sun City have cast iron.
